>This warning
> > <stdin>:2: warning: Illegal digit in octal number "008000"
>may be ignored.  It does not appear to affect the functioning of the
>xrdb command.
>
>A bit more information:  xrdb files may use C-style macros.  This is
>done by invoking the C preprocessor.  On Ubuntu LTS, the preprocessor
>that xrdb invokes is called 'mcpp_prestd'.  It issues this warning, but
>also gives the desired result.  Example:
>
>     $ echo '080' | mcpp_prestd  2>/dev/null
>     # 1 "<stdin>"
>     080
>
>You may silence this erroneous warning by using
>     xrdb -cpp "/usr/bin/mcpp_prestd [EMAIL PROTECTED] -W0" -merge filename
